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of material used, such as concrete, pavers, or natural stone, significantly impacts the cost.
- Area Size: Larger areas will require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om patterns can raise the price due to additional labor and materials.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ing site, including any necessary excavation or leveling, can affect costs.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s can vary depending on the contractor and their level of expertise.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ations and the need for permits can add to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Newport Beach, CA)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Paving | $10 - $15 per square foot |
Paver Installation | $15 - $25 per square foot |
Natural Stone Paving | $20 - $40 per square foot |
Site Preparation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Custom Design Work | Additional $5 - $10 per square foot |
